Output 63a3f791496dfc1ba7e081ddf9aa40be8280f42fe613893b58542c165475488c:1

value
421038
script pubkey
OP_0 OP_PUSHBYTES_20 34d554d2762808c431765fa7ecc65b9eb2ad341e
address
bc1qxn24f5nk9qyvgvtkt7n7e3jmn6e26dq7vyx89z
transaction
63a3f791496dfc1ba7e081ddf9aa40be8280f42fe613893b58542c165475488c
spent
true